However there are other factors, considering that many modern harnesses are constructed of some sort of heavy nylon, this material can be severely weakened by long term exposure to the sun, as such the buyer should test the harness' flexibility, look for faded colors, as well as ask how the harness was stored when not in use. In general, harnesses will all have the same basic features: two leg loops, a waist belt with one or two auto-locking buckles, a belay loop that joins the leg loops to the waist belt, and gear loops along the sides of the waist belt for clipping in gear.
